
Three volcanoes in one park.
Los Volcanes National Park brings together Santa Ana, Izalco, and Cerro Verde in a cloud forest of great biodiversity, serving as the base for the most famous hikes in the west.

It is the only park of MARN where you don't need to make a reservation: you can go directly to the San Blas or Las Brumas sectors without prior notice.
Entrance: San Blas sector $2, Los Andes sector $3 for Salvadorans and $6 for foreigners. Students with ID pay $1 (private) or $0.50 (public). Cash only.
San Blas has its own schedule: Monday to Friday from 7:30 to 11:30 a.m., and Saturdays and Sundays it opens from 3:30 a.m. for the early morning ascent to Ilamatepec.
